Weather in January

Weather in Valjevo, Serbia for January is usually defined by the frosty temperature and the generous snowfall. Temperatures can plunge as low as -2.8°C (27°F), and the city can expect to receive 195mm (7.68") of snowfall, making the whole city seem like a winter wonderland. January could be an excellent destination for snow-lovers looking for an exciting winter adventure with snowball fights and skiing. However, lovers of sunshine might find the balance a bit off as the sun blesses the city with fewer daylight hours. Ice-glazed roads and sidewalks make transportation a challenge during this month.

Temperature

With an average high-temperature of 3.3°C (37.9°F) and an average low-temperature of -2.8°C (27°F), January is the coldest month.

Humidity

The most humid month is January, with an average relative humidity of 85%.

Rainfall

In Valjevo, in January, during 10.8 rainfall days, 42mm (1.65") of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Valjevo, there are 157.7 rainfall days, and 587mm (23.11")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through April, November and December are months with snowfall. The month with the most snowfall in Valjevo is January, when snow falls for 10.1 days and typically aggregates up to 195mm (7.68") of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January in Valjevo is 9h and 19min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 07:15 and sunset at 16:11. On the last day of January, in Valjevo, Serbia, sunrise is at 06:59 and sunset at 16:47 CET.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in January is 4.8h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: In January, the maximum UV index of 2 translates into these guidelines:
Most people face no serious problems with extended sun exposure, but those with fair skin, infants, and children always need protection. To protect against the Sun's most potent rays, avoid direct exposure around midday. For optimum UV protection, wear sun-resistant attire complemented with a hat and quality shades. Be cautious! The UV radiation from the Sun can be magnified almost twofold by snow reflection.
